Clients referred from the court for drug or alcohol rehabilitation are most commonly referred because they are being granted a chance to accept rehab in lieu of jail time, other charges, fines, etc. While this is most common among first time offenders, it can be offered at any point including while the defendant is being held in jail. There are various types of programs that criminal justice clients can be referred to, and this depends on what is attainable in Kirkland and the type of drug or alcohol the person requires treatment for.

There are rehab facilities that work directly with the criminal justice court system to administer to this explicit type of clientele, and are usually state funded or are offered at little or no cost to the client. Additionally, there are also private substance abuse treatment programs that can be accepted by the court if there is a specific type of rehabilitation that the person needs or desires that a different program can't fulfill. The client's attorney can propose such alternatives to the judge for approval. There are even addiction treatment centers that operate out of the correctional institutions themselves, whereas clients are often in a better position for reduced sentences or other leniencies when participating in drug and alcohol treatment services while serving their sentence for a drug related offense or a DUI/DWI.
